How to prepare for a job interview at Teaching Personnel

✨Know Your EYFS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on the Early Years Foundation Stage framework. Understand its principles and how they guide your teaching. Be ready to discuss how you can implement these in your lessons and support children's development.

✨Showcase Your Passion for Teaching

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through. Share personal anecdotes or experiences that highlight your dedication to nurturing young learners. This will help you connect with the interviewers and demonstrate your commitment.

✨Prepare Engaging Lesson Ideas

Think of a few creative lesson ideas that encourage learning through play and child-led activities. Be prepared to discuss how you would implement these in the classroom, as this shows your proactive approach to engaging students.

✨Familiarise Yourself with the School's Values

Research the school’s ethos and values before the interview. Understanding their approach to education and community involvement will allow you to tailor your responses and show how you align with their mission.
